Abstract
In this paper we apply the modified method of multiple scales to study the postbuckling behaviors of annular and circular thin plates. The asymptotic solutions have been constructed, the ultimate loads have been determined, and the relations between the length of twisted waves formed by buckling and the flexural rigidity of plates have been discovered.
